Keeping up appearances

‘George Bernard Shaw famously opined that all professions are conspiracies against the laity. Though one would hardly expect the Law Societies’ Gazette to subscribe to this view, research commissioned by the Solicitors Regulation Authority may explain why this canard-cum-cliche is so frustratingly enduring. One in five clients claim to be dissatisfied with the service they receive from a solicitor, yet it is clear that poor communication rather than, for example, incompetence or maladministration is largely to blame.
